Hunting for Japan surplus in Nueva Ecija? We track 58 shops across 21 cities and towns in the area. These stores sell second-hand furniture, appliances, kitchenware, bikes and tools imported from Japan, usually at a fraction of the new price.
The biggest clusters are in Cabanatuan City (14), Talavera (8) and Jaen (4). Pick a city below to compare every shop in it, or scroll down for the full Nueva Ecija list.
Among rated stores, JMP Japan Surplus in Talavera currently leads with 5.0 out of 5 from 4 Google reviews. Stock turns over as new container shipments arrive, so call ahead before a long trip.

What do Japan surplus shops in Nueva Ecija sell?
Typical stock includes solid-wood furniture, home appliances, kitchenware, mamachari bicycles, power tools, toys and multicab parts, all second-hand imports from Japan. Inventory changes with every shipment, so it is worth calling ahead or visiting when a new container arrives.
